To do this trick, simply triple jump onto the slope on the side (any slope will work), and slide down head-first.
In the first section, this results in a hugely fast speed because the initial part of the dive is much faster than the rest of the dive. Since the height of the dive is so low, the dive is reset almost immediately, meaning Mario can keep travelling at the velocity of the fastest part of the dive.
In the second section, the long jumps are so high that a large amount of the level can be skipped. To do this, the trick is done in reverse.
